#d627f5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d627f5 is composed of 83.9% red, 15.3%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.7% cyan, 84.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 291 degrees, a saturation of 91.2% and a lightness of 55.7%. #d627f5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4eff with #ad00eb. Closest websafe color is: #cc33ff.

Shades and Tints of #d627f5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080009 is the darkest color, while #fdf5ff is the lightest one.
